How to Choose the Right Shein Jeans for Your Body Type
Picking denim that flatters starts with knowing shapes and proportions. This brief guide helps you choose Shein jeans by comparing denim silhouettes and matching them to common frames. Follow simple Shein jeans fit tips and the rise and inseam guide to get a look that feels planned and natural.
Understanding denim silhouettes
Skinny jeans fit close from hip to ankle and create a sleek line that works well under long tops or with boots. Straight jeans keep a constant width from hip to hem and give a balanced, timeless silhouette. Wide-leg styles free the thigh and lower leg, adding movement and a fashion-forward feel. Mom and relaxed cuts sit higher at the waist and taper toward the ankle for a vintage, comfy look. Consider hybrids like skinny-straight if you want structure without tightness.
Tips for petite, tall, curvy, and athletic frames
Petite shoppers should choose higher rises and cropped hems to lengthen the leg line. Avoid excess fabric that can overwhelm a smaller frame. Tall customers benefit from longer inseams and full-length straight or wide-leg styles to keep proportions balanced. Mid- to high-rise options help equalize torso length.
Curvy figures often find comfort in jeans with stretch and contoured waists. High-rise styles smooth the midsection and offer more coverage. Try curvy-specific cuts when available and consider sizing for hips while altering the waist for the best fit. Athletic builds can add dimension with wide-leg or relaxed fits and mid-rise styles to define the waist. Low-rise options may emphasize a straighter silhouette, so pick based on the curves you want to highlight.
How rise and inseam affect fit and proportion
Rise determines where the waistband sits. Low-rise sits below the hips, mid-rise hits around the natural hip bone, and high-rise sits at or above the natural waist. High-rise can make legs appear longer, while mid-rise offers everyday comfort for many body types. Choose low-rise if you prefer lower waist placement.
Inseam choices change the final look. Cropped lengths show ankle and pair well with sneakers or sandals. Ankle-length jeans suit most casual looks. Long inseams work with taller heights or when you want to cover shoes. Match inseam to shoe style and the visual effect you want.
Use Shein product descriptions and size charts before you buy. Read review measurements and look at user photos for real-world insight. These steps help you choose Shein jeans that match your body and your style.

Sizing Guide and How to Measure for Shein Jeans
Choosing the right size can make the difference between a great look and a frustrating return. This guide walks through how to measure and how to use those numbers with the Shein size chart so you get a reliable fit every time.
Step-by-step measuring instructions
Use a flexible tape and stand in thin clothing. To measure waist, wrap the tape around the narrowest part of your torso. For hips, measure around the fullest part of your hips and buttocks. To check rise, measure from the crotch seam up to the top of the waistband on a pair that fits well. For inseam, measure the inside leg from crotch seam to hem.
Converting measurements to the Shein size chart
Open the Shein size chart on each product page and match your waist and hip numbers to the chart. Prioritize hips for tight styles and waist for high-rise jeans. If you shop by U.S. sizes, compare your measurements to the listed conversions. Shein sometimes shows S/M/L plus numeric sizes, so use your actual inches to pick the closest match.
Common fit issues and how to troubleshoot them
If hips feel tight but the waist is loose, try sizing up and use a small alteration at the waist or choose a stretch denim. If thighs rub or the back waist gapes, consider a curvy fit or a different cut with more rise. For length problems, hem to the desired length or pick a different inseam option. Expect some variation between styles; check fabric composition for stretch percentages and read reviews for “size up” or “size down” notes.
Practical tips
Measure an older pair of jeans that fits well and compare those numbers to product measurements on Shein. Keep return policies in mind before ordering multiple sizes. When in doubt, read customer photos and fit feedback for jean fit troubleshooting that reflects real wear.

Caring for Your Shein Jeans to Extend Longevity

Good denim care keeps your favorite pairs looking newer, longer. Use simple habits to extend life of jeans and protect color, fit, and fabric. Treat them gently and wash only when needed to get the most from Shein denim.
Washing and drying best practices
Turn jeans inside out before washing to guard the dye and details. Choose a cold, gentle cycle and a mild detergent. These wash denim tips reduce fading and fiber stress.
Avoid chlorine bleach and heavy detergents. For stretch denim, skip high heat. Air-dry flat or hang by the waistband to maintain shape. Use the dryer rarely; if you must, pick a low-heat setting to avoid shrinkage and breakdown.
Wash less often. Spot clean stains with a damp cloth and air garments between wears to preserve fabric and color.
Repair tips for small rips and fading
Tackle small tears quickly to prevent larger damage. Use iron-on patches or fabric glue for fast fixes. Sew rips with a matching thread when you can for a cleaner look.
Reinforce high-stress areas like pockets and inner thighs with internal patches. For faded dark denim, try a color-restoring dye designed for garments, or embrace the worn look as a vintage finish.
Major damage benefits from professional tailoring. Learning basic mending extends life and keeps jeans wearable while you save for a full repair.
Storage recommendations to maintain shape
Fold jeans neatly or hang by the waistband on wide hangers to prevent creases and distortion. Avoid overstuffed drawers that stretch waistbands and warp fit.
Store jeans in a cool, dry place. For long-term storage, ensure pairs are clean and fully dry to prevent mildew or yellowing. Rotate styles in your wardrobe so each pair gets air and light between wears.

Customer Reviews and Fit Feedback on Shein Jeans
Shopping for jeans online gets easier when you learn how to read product reviews and use them to predict fit. Shein jeans reviews and customer feedback Shein denim often point toward common wins and recurring issues. Short notes from verified buyers help you match a pair to your style and size before checkout.
Common praise covers trendy cuts, wide wash choices, and low prices. Many shoppers praise comfortable stretch in select collections and flattering high-rise shapes. A steady flow of new drops keeps the selection fresh for seasonal looks.
Recurring complaints include inconsistent sizing between styles and uneven quality across different batches. Some buyers report limited long-term durability and thinner denim than expected. These points show up repeatedly in Shein fit feedback and are worth noting.
Follow a quick checklist when you read product reviews. Give weight to reviews that list height, weight, and the size worn. Watch for multiple mentions of “size up” or “true to size” to find consensus. Recent reviews matter most because styles and cuts change fast.
Look past star ratings and scan review text for fabric feel, denim weight, and stretch level. Many reviewers describe how jeans shifted after washing or how the waistband fits. This kind of detail improves your chance of choosing the right size from Shein fit feedback reports.
Real customer photos offer the clearest view of color, rise, and length. Compare user shots to studio images to spot differences in wash, fade, or distressing. Filtering reviews by body type or height gives a better idea of how a specific pair will look on you.
Combine review insights with the size chart and seller measurements before you buy. Use customer feedback Shein denim alongside exact waist and inseam numbers to reduce return risk. When many reviewers share similar experience, those patterns help you shop with confidence.
